Handset Error Messages –
Handset error messages can be a powerful tool for any administrator when
determining the reason for a handset failure. Error messages can aid in determining
whether the handset's configuration is inconsistent with the site requirements or to
help pinpoint the potential source of the problem, such as a PBX issue or possible
coverage issue.
The following is a list of error messages that may result in a handset being returned
for RMA replacement and the troubleshooting steps that should be attempted prior
to seeking a replacement.

In call: the battery icon displays and a
soft beep will be heard when the user
is on the handset and the battery
charge is low. User has 15-30 minutes
of battery life left.
The Battery Pack can be changed
while the call is still in progress. Do not
press the END key. Quickly remove
the discharged Battery Pack and
replace with a charged Battery Pack,
power on the handset and press the
START key to resume the call in
progress.
Not in call: The battery icon displays
whenever the Battery Pack charge is
low. The message Low Battery and a
loud beep indicate a critically low
battery charge when user is not on the
handset. The handset will not work
until the Battery Pack is charged.
Replace the Battery Pack with a new
or confirmed SpectraLink Battery
Pack. Any non-SpectraLink Battery
Packs will not work.
